| Name | (2,3,4,5,6-pentachlorophenyl) benzenesulfonate |
|---|---|
| Synonyms |
pentachlorophenyl benzenesulfonate
benzenesulfonic acid pentachlorophenyl ester Benzolsulfonsaeure-pentachlorphenylester |
| Density | 1.673g/cm3 |
|---|---|
| Boiling Point | 515.5ºC at 760 mmHg |
| Molecular Formula | C12H5Cl5O3S |
| Molecular Weight | 406.49600 |
| Flash Point | 265.5ºC |
| Exact Mass | 403.84000 |
| PSA | 51.75000 |
| LogP | 6.80210 |
| Index of Refraction | 1.627 |
